Veterans Day to be celebrated downtown on Friday, Nov. 11

by design | Nov 8, 2016 | The Daily Focus

Knoxville will honor the service of its U.S. military veterans with the City’s 91st annual Veterans Day Parade on Friday morning, Nov. 11.   The parade will line up in the eastbound lanes of Howard H. Baker Jr. Avenue, with the step-off at 10:45 a.m. in front of...

Sevierville kicks off 27th Annual Smoky Mountain Winterfest Celebration on November 7

by design | Nov 6, 2016 | The Daily Focus

Sevierville will kick off the 27th Annual Smoky Mountain Winterfest Celebration with the annual Music, Lights & Magic event on November 7 at the Sevierville Municipal Complex. This completely free event annually draws around 7,000 spectators who enjoy...
